Mamas Circle Frequently Asked Questions

What is Mamas Circle?
Mamas Circles are communities of moms - and their little ones - who meet to share the intense and amazing experience of being a mom. These groups have been meeting for over 4 years and have served hundreds of mothers! 

Who can join?
We welcome ALL moms and embrace diversity in background, sexual orientation, age, race, religion, etc. 

Mamas Circle - Newborns is open to any mom with a newborn to pre-crawling baby and Motherhood Circles are open to moms with young children. The groups are all usually a good mix of new and veteran mamas - first-time, second-time or moms with many more children are welcome. 

When should I join?
The short answer is join when you are ready! The youngest baby to join Mamas Circle - Newborns was just 5 days old but most babies are 1-4 months old. Since this group is run in 6-week sessions you should find one starting around the time you are looking for.

Moms in our Motherhood Circles have toddlers and young children and join (or re-join after being part of a newborn circle) for a sense of community, a place to explore their own way to mother, and to celebrate (and commiserate!) about being a parent. 

How many other moms will be in my group? What will they be like?

In Mamas Circle - Newborns you'll meet between 6-10 other moms with 0-4 month old babies - many are on maternity leave but a few may have decided to take additional time off work or transition to working part time. There will be first time moms and moms with other children. 

Motherhood Circles are intimate groups of 4-8 moms. These moms are settling into parenting but still have lots of questions, want to parent with consciousness and intention, and be part of a community. Most moms have children between 6 months and 6 years old. 


Will I get anything out of this group if it is virtual?
Yes! You'll get to connect with other moms on a weekly basis from the comfort of your own home.

In our current groups some of the moms are meeting up for physically distant walks or picnics and everyone is in touch in-between sessions, others are simply keeping the connections virtual. All of our groups over the last 6 months are still actively engaged- which really is the whole idea! You'll have a wonderful group of moms with babies around the same age to check-in with about small questions and big changes that will happen over the months and years as you raise your little one. 


What makes Mamas Circle different from other moms groups?
Mamas Circle is a community and its content is truly mom-inspired. By not having a strict curriculum we have ample time each week to talk about what you need most - whether its help with baby's sleep, the changing relationship with your spouse, how to find time for yourself, or something else entirely. Mamas Circle is the beginning of lasting friendships that continue well beyond the session with play dates, wine nights, and more.

Motherhood Circles are the only groups of their kind in the DC area! Moms and older babies are invited to share in a (currently virtual) space on a weekly or monthly basis, with the focus on building community. These groups allow moms to connect, explore our shifting identities, go deeper into how to navigate the changing relationships in our lives, and truly share with others who are in it with you.

Can I drop-in to one week or start mid-session?
We don't have drop-ins - each week we get to know each other a little better and share the details of our lives and it's not conducive to have moms just come for a session or two. The positive part of this is when everyone commits to the group it creates a really wonderful and supportive place to return to, 

Mamas Circle - Newborns the groups are closed after the second meeting of the session. Moms may be able to join the Motherhood Circles mid-session if space is available.

What if I am going to miss a week? Is there a way to make-up? 
Due to the session/cohort model there are no make-ups and we are only able to prorate the group fee if you are joining late.
